Biden Steps Aside, Harris Takes Lead in 2024 Presidential Race
Democratic National Convention adapts to new dynamics as Harris prepares to accept nomination.
- Biden announces decision to not seek re-election, citing the need for a new generation of leadership.
- Harris set to make history as the first woman of color nominated by a major party for president.
- Convention planners face logistical challenges and a compressed timeline to reframe the event.
- Biden will have a ceremonial role at the convention, focusing on his administration's achievements.
- Harris's campaign reorients its strategy, emphasizing fresh energy and policy continuity.
